Introducing an In-Depth Exploration of Variable Speed Bench Grinder Market Dynamics and Core Imperatives for Stakeholders in Modern Tool Management

Variable speed bench grinders have evolved from simple abrasive tools to sophisticated workhorses that cater to a diverse spectrum of applications, ranging from heavy industrial fabrication to intricate hobbyist projects. Their ability to precisely adjust rotational speed not only enhances operational flexibility but also improves process control and surface finish quality. As manufacturing processes demand ever-greater precision and adaptability, the variable speed bench grinder has emerged as a cornerstone in workshops and production lines alike.

Against this backdrop of rising performance expectations, stakeholders across the value chain are seeking deeper insight into the factors driving market adoption and innovation. End users, distributors, and manufacturers alike must navigate a complex landscape shaped by technological breakthroughs, shifting regulatory frameworks, and dynamic end-user requirements. Moreover, evolving distribution models and diversifying application needs underscore the critical importance of strategic decision-making informed by robust, comprehensive research.

Charting Key Technological and Sustainability-Led Shifts That Are Redefining Variable Speed Bench Grinder Performance and Driving Next-Generation Use Cases

Over the past decade, the variable speed bench grinder landscape has undergone a profound transformation propelled by the convergence of cutting-edge motor control technologies and heightened sustainability imperatives. Advances in electronic speed regulation have given end users unprecedented precision, enabling them to seamlessly transition between light polishing tasks and demanding material removal processes without sacrificing surface integrity. Furthermore, the integration of digital interfaces and programmable speed profiles has enhanced repeatability and reduced operator fatigue, unlocking new productivity benchmarks.

Simultaneously, escalating concerns around energy efficiency and noise pollution have driven manufacturers to prioritize motor and component enhancements that minimize power consumption and mitigate acoustic emissions. As a result, modern grinders boast brushless motor architectures and vibration damping systems that adhere to increasingly stringent environmental guidelines and occupational safety standards. Coupled with the shift toward eco-friendly abrasives and recyclable wheel formulations, these developments underscore an industry-wide commitment to sustainable manufacturing practices.

Moreover, a user-centric innovation wave is emerging, characterized by modular attachments, quick-change wheel guards, and mobile connectivity for real-time performance monitoring. These innovations are reshaping expectations around customization and maintenance, enabling proactive service interventions and data-driven productivity improvements. Consequently, the variable speed bench grinder market is moving beyond a traditional commodity mindset into a realm defined by intelligent, adaptable, and environmentally conscious solutions.

Understanding the Far-Reaching Implications of United States Tariff Changes in 2025 for Variable Speed Bench Grinder Manufacturing and Distribution Channels

Recent policy developments in the United States have introduced a fresh layer of complexity to the global variable speed bench grinder supply chain. The 2025 tariff revisions imposed on imported metalworking equipment are designed to protect domestic manufacturing interests but could elevate production costs for companies reliant on cross-border sourcing. As duty rates adjust upward, stakeholders will face decisions regarding price adjustments, localization of component sourcing, or lean‐inventory strategies to mitigate margin erosion.

Given these emerging constraints, manufacturers are evaluating near-shoring initiatives and establishing strategic partnerships with domestic metal component suppliers to sustain assembly volumes while preserving quality standards. In parallel, some distributors are exploring tariff‐excluded or tariff‐minimized categories for specific spare parts, thereby optimizing total landed costs for end‐user customers. Such measures underscore the importance of proactive supply chain agility in the face of evolving trade policy.

Furthermore, finance and procurement teams are recalibrating cost models to account for the indirect effects of tariffs, including currency fluctuations and logistics rate adjustments. By leveraging dynamic cost-forecasting tools and scenario planning exercises, organizations are building resilience into their capital allocation frameworks. Ultimately, the 2025 tariff landscape serves as a catalyst for strategic realignment, encouraging greater vertical integration and advanced planning to safeguard profitability and maintain competitive positioning.

Unveiling How Segmentation Across End-User Profiles, Distribution Channels, Applications, Power Outputs, Wheel Sizes, and Speed Ranges Fuels Market Differentiation

Segmentation analysis reveals that the variable speed bench grinder market is shaped by a rich tapestry of end-user requirements, distribution pathways, application nuances, power classifications, wheel configurations, and rotational velocity preferences. For instance, the automotive segment encompasses both aftermarket repair operations focused on tire buffing and cylinder head polishing as well as original equipment manufacturers demanding precise surface finishing for engine components. Meanwhile, the do-it-yourself home workshop domain accommodates general consumers who seek cost-effective hobbyist machines alongside skilled enthusiasts requiring enhanced control and accessory compatibility.

Industrial users, in contrast, are bifurcated between heavy manufacturing facilities and lighter precision-driven workshops, each prioritizing distinct power outputs and durability benchmarks. Distribution channels further diversify the landscape: broad-reach mass merchants cater to entry-level purchasers, while specialized grinding outlets and online platforms serve professional operators with tailored product assortments and technical support. Application-centric segmentation highlights the differing demands of buffing, polishing, sharpening, and both precision and surface grinding tasks. Power output tiers range from sub-half-horsepower units suited to delicate benchwork, through one to two horsepower systems balancing torque and control, up to robust models exceeding two horsepower for continuous industrial operations.

Wheel size preferences likewise vary, with smaller six-inch and eight-inch units favored for confined workspaces, and larger ten-inch or twelve-inch configurations deployed in heavy-duty environments. Finally, rotational speed requirements span from entry-level setups operating between fifteen hundred and three thousand RPM to high-performance machines exceeding four thousand five hundred RPM, with many users exploiting mid-range and sub-range settings for fine-tuned process control. Together, these segmentation dimensions offer a comprehensive framework for aligning product development, distribution strategies, and go-to-market initiatives.

Highlighting Key Dynamics Across the Americas, Europe Middle East and Africa, and Asia-Pacific Shaping Variable Speed Bench Grinder Market Evolution

Regional dynamics play a pivotal role in shaping the variable speed bench grinder market, with distinct demand drivers and regulatory environments influencing industry evolution. In the Americas, a matured automotive aftermarket segment coexists with a broad base of small and medium-sized industrial fabricators. These end users increasingly prioritize reduced downtime and enhanced safety features, leading to growing adoption of rapid-wheel-change mechanisms and improved spark containment systems. Economic stability in key markets underpins steady demand for premium grinder variants, while consumer and hobbyist interest remains buoyant amid growing maker-space communities.

Europe, the Middle East, and Africa present a heterogeneous environment where stringent emissions regulations and energy efficiency mandates have catalyzed the introduction of next-gen motor and noise reduction technologies. Heavy industry hubs in Germany and the United Kingdom emphasize high-precision surface grinding for aerospace and defense applications, whereas emerging economies in Eastern Europe and the Gulf region leverage cost-effective imports to support infrastructure growth. Cross-border regulatory alignment within the European Union facilitates streamlined product certification but also imposes rigorous compliance benchmarks for safety and electromagnetic compatibility.

Asia-Pacific exhibits the most dynamic growth potential, driven by rapid industrialization, booming automotive assembly operations, and expanding home improvement sectors. China and India are witnessing the proliferation of compact, lower-cost grinder models to serve small manufacturing workshops, while Japan and South Korea continue to push the envelope on high-RPM, high-precision designs. E-commerce channels are especially influential in this region, accelerating cross-border transactions and enabling agile product launches into new market segments.

Examining Competitive Strategies and Technological Investments Among Leading Variable Speed Bench Grinder Manufacturers to Unearth Industry Best Practices

Leading companies in the variable speed bench grinder arena are differentiating themselves through strategic investments in advanced motor control, digital integration, and collaborative innovation networks. Established global manufacturers have intensified research and development efforts, deploying brushless motor platforms and IoT-enabled interfaces that allow remote monitoring of load, temperature, and maintenance intervals. Simultaneously, several firms have pursued targeted acquisitions of specialty abrasive producers to secure proprietary wheel formulations and ensure uninterrupted supply of high-performance grinding mediums.

Strategic partnerships with industrial automation providers are another common thread, enabling seamless integration of bench grinders into larger production cell ecosystems. By collaborating with robotics and sensor solution experts, innovators are embedding real-time feedback loops that optimize grinding parameters for complex metal alloys. Moreover, certain market leaders have adopted direct-to-consumer digital storefronts, reducing reliance on traditional distribution channels and strengthening customer relationships through tailored training resources and virtual support services.

A parallel trend involves the formation of cross-industry consortia aimed at establishing open protocols for machine-to-machine communication and predictive maintenance standards. These collaborative initiatives not only accelerate the adoption of smart grinding technologies but also foster a shared innovation roadmap that benefits the entire value chain. Collectively, these company-led endeavors underscore a market in which competitive advantage is increasingly driven by technological leadership and ecosystem co-creation.
